About this contract

Stoke-on-Trent City Council are looking to procure a Supported Living and Social Opportunities Framework. The Services will enhance and support the wellbeing of individuals by improving the offer and quality of services available for local residents with a learning disability and/or autism who may show behaviour that can be challenges, and those with a mental health condition and physical disabilities, helping achieve their outcome and to stay safe. The supported living element of the framework will be for care and support services and the Social Opportunities will include building-based opportunities and outreach services. This contract falls under the Public Contract Regulations 2015 Light Touch Regime (LTR) - Regulations 74 to 77. As such, the City Council will place an advert in Find a Tender Service (FTS), publish an award notice and comply with the principles of transparency and equal treatment. The contract will re-open annually to allow new providers to join the framework.
